Division IV playoff preview

DIVISION IV SEMIFINALS
CAPSULE PREVIEWS

Raymond vs. Winnisquam

When and where: Saturday (2 p.m.) in Tilton.
Team records: Top-seeded Winnisquam is 7-0. Fourth-seeded Raymond is 3-4.
Regular-season result: Winnisquam won 39-0 in Tilton.
Noteworthy: The Bears had no trouble during the regular-season matchup between these teams. Winnisquam scored 26 points in the first half and led 39-0 after three quarters. The Bears had 404 yards of offense, including 303 yards on the ground. … Raymond ended a three-game losing streak and earned the No. 4 seed by beating Mascoma 22-18 last weekend. The Rams went 0-3 against other Division IV playoff teams during the regular season. … Winnisquam fullback Angelo Glover ran for 122 yards and a touchdown on 15 carries during the regular-season meeting. Quarterback Phil Nichols rushed for 97 yards and two touchdowns on five carries, and completed 4 of 10 passes for 101 yards and a TD. … Winnisquam is one of four unbeaten teams in the state, joining Bedford (Division I), Plymouth (Division II) and Monadnock (Division III). … The winner will face either third-seeded Franklin or second-seeded Newfound in next Saturday’s championship game at Laconia High School.

Franklin vs. Newfound

When and where: Saturday (1 p.m.) in Bristol.
Team records: Third-seeded Franklin is 5-2. Fourth-seeded Newfound is 6-1.
Regular-season result: Newfound won 18-0 in Franklin.
Noteworthy: Franklin’s 18-0 loss to Newfound earlier this season doesn’t look so bad when you consider the Golden Tornadoes turned the ball over nine times in the game (six interceptions). Each of Franklin six first-half possessions ended with a turnover. … Newfound received 123 yards rushing on 23 carries from running back Tiellar Mitchell in the first meeting. Newfound’s Brett Pidgeon scored two touchdowns in that game. Pidgeon scored on a 16-yard run, and on a 20-yard pass from Logan Rouille. It was Newfound’s only completed pass in the win.  The Bears also received a 3-yard touchdown run from fullback Shawn Huckins. … Franklin enters the playoffs having been shut out in each of its last two games (Newfound and Winnisquam). … Kainan Clark led the Golden Tornadoes with 99 yards rushing on 17 carries in the first game against Newfound.
